Best 6 Key Insights into DC and AC Ratio for Solar Power

The DC and AC Ratio is the ratio of a solar array''s DC capacity to the inverter''s AC capacity. It is typically aimed at between 1.2 and 1.5 to improve energy yield without additional inverter costs.

DC/AC Ratio: Choosing the Right Size Solar Inverter

The DC-to-AC ratio, also known as the Inverter Loading Ratio (ILR), is the ratio of the installed DC capacity of your solar panels to the AC power rating of your inverter.
